## Local setup

Hey plugin folks! GiftQuill's receipt mailer runs fine on a laptop. Clone the repo, run `make seed` to get fake donors and a test SMTP sink, then start the worker with `make mailer`. Templates hot-reload, so tinker away. For the seed step, point the mailer at the dev database using the connection string below.

replica DSN, yahaf-yagaf: mongodb://tamath_svc:a2netSk3RZMuTj@db-d084.novacsoft.internal:5432/ralmir

# Break-Glass Access — Driftmark Assignment Service

If the Driftmark A/B assignment service stalls and experiment buckets stop resolving, on-call may invoke break-glass access to force the fallback allocator. Log the action in the Hollowbrook runbook and notify the sync channel. To activate break-glass mode, supply the recovery passphrase listed immediately below.

unlock words, hahip-baduf: holwyn-istath-julvan

# GraphLens Environments

GraphLens (dependency graph visualizer) runs in three environments: dev, staging, prod. Dev is open to the Oakmere engineering VPN only. Staging ingests sanitized manifests; prod ingests live build metadata from the Pellworth pipeline. Render workers are sandboxed, no outbound network. Auth is delegated to the internal SSO broker; sessions expire hourly. Secrets rotate quarterly. For the security review, the production instance currently runs with the following values.

deployment values, yagaf-tawif:
[zorael]
team = pelix
access_code = ac_be383e
host = zorael.tolvaqio.internal
port = 8080
owner = druath.ulador
peer = fendor.tolvaqcorp.corp

## Ticket: Fabrikit factory env misconfigured on dev boxes

New hires keep hitting seed failures because the default `.env` shipped in the Fabrikit starter repo points at the retired Nollport fixture store. Symptoms: factories build in-memory but persistence calls 403. Fix: pull latest starter repo, delete stale `.env`, regenerate via `make env`. Do not copy env files between machines. The regenerated file is correct except for one missing entry — the fixture-store credential, which must be appended manually as the following line:

sealed setting: VAULT_KEY13=741e0a90de233